Proportional rubrics for heroes, like those found in the "Marvel Universe," are largely a thing of the past. And by extension, the scaling of figs in correlation to what's presented currently in comics has become a fool's errand. It's safe to say that between figs, movies, and books little to nothing matters anymore as it pertains to height and weight presentations. Hell, power sets don't even matter much any longer; I've read recent comments explaining that heroes' "peaks" are determined by feats, not actual powers when explaining how the Living Tribunal could be killed by Hyperion (really, WTF?).

Everything is now a matter of artistic expression, personal preference/character popularity, and the 'era' on which one was weaned within comic culture. I'm a Gen-X-er, so my sensibilities are heavily steeped in "How to Draw Comics the Marvel Way" and the "Marvel Universe." I bought HtDtMW when it came out (1884; when I was a wee tyke) and it taught me many things about illustrating and Marvel as a whole. What I learned was that Marvel had guidelines for the presentation of their characters, which in turn were enforced by lineal talents from the Buscema, Romita, and Kubert families (just to name a few). So, for me, and similar to what Parademon1 laid out (although I disagree about Uatu, despite using him in recent photos and his height being variable, the fig is too short for even the Legends line - additionally, I'd add Select Mephisto and Destroyer to your "acceptable" list), the proportions in today's comics and the scale of many figures are totally out of whack. That said, Baby Boomer comic fans might say the same thing about my bronze & copper-age impressions...and we all know, Millennials have no F'n clue about anything. (I kid, I kid...somebody has to consume this new tripe! ...again I joke lol)

In any event, I'd say put into your collection or take pics of whatever makes sense to you. The books no longer have a standard for presentation of these heroes (or a standard for almost anything else, for that matter) and we live in age where almost anything goes...not unlike (purposeful use a double negative) "The Lord of the Flies"....
